So, as you can probably tell from my way too many posts, I design album pages for Ukrainian stamps. Every year Ukraine issues a Europa stamp as a mini-sheet and a booklet. The stamps are physically different sizes and are assigned unique Michel numbers.

When I design my pages, I have places to mount the stamps (usually a se-tenant), and the stamps in the booklet.

I am now wondering it it would be a good idea to provide the ability to mount the whole booklet.

I have had this same discussion in my mind every time I mount a booklet, if I have two then I will mount the booklet as it came from the philatelic service the other will be mounted open. If I only have one copy the I mount it as it came. Not sure if that helps or not....but that's what I do...sometimes.

Andy, My experience with this is Netherlands. Back in the good old days the Davo albums used to carry the insides only. The whole booklet was collected separately due to it's thickness! Peter
